Best London Airports for Private Jet Arrivals
London City Airport (LCY)
Located in the heart of East London, LCY is the closest airport to Canary Wharf and the financial district. While slots are limited, it offers unmatched convenience for executives attending central London events.
London Biggin Hill Airport (BQH)
Just 25 minutes by car or helicopter transfer to Canary Wharf, Biggin Hill specializes in private aviation. Its dedicated FBOs provide fast-track arrivals, luxury lounges, and discreet handling.
London Farnborough Airport (FAB)
Renowned as the UK’s leading private aviation airport, Farnborough delivers world-class service, 24/7 availability, and efficient customs clearance. It’s a top choice during peak banking conferences thanks to its ability to handle high volumes of executive flights.
Private Jet Costs to London During Banking Events
Pricing depends on the aircraft type, route, and demand during conference weeks. Below is an indicative cost guide for flights into London from popular European hubs:
| Route | Aircraft Type | Seats | Approx. Cost (One-Way) | Flight Time |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Paris – London | Very Light Jet | 4–5 | €6,000 – €8,000 | 1h 00m |
| Frankfurt – London | Light Jet | 6–7 | €8,500 – €11,000 | 1h 20m |
| Zurich – London | Midsize Jet | 7–9 | €12,000 – €16,000 | 1h 30m |
| New York – London | Heavy Jet | 12–14 | €75,000 – €95,000 | 7h 00m |
